#!/bin/bash
# -*- Mode: sh; indent-tabs-mode: nil; tab-width: 2 -*-

# Ensure the shell always gets unthrottled touch events, so that applications
# who want full speed low-latency input can get it (LP: #1497105) and so that
# apps can use QML touch compression safely (the QML touch compression
# algorithm does not support nesting well - LP: #1486341, LP: #1556763 - so
# must be fed by the raw input event stream from Unity8).
export QML_NO_TOUCH_COMPRESSION=1

export MIR_SERVER_PROMPT_FILE=1

# Hard code socket path because our snappy apparmor profile
# only lets us put the socket in one place.  And consumers expect it there.
# (XDG_RUNTIME_DIR isn't typical under snappy)
export MIR_SERVER_FILE=/run/user/$(id -u)/mir_socket

rm -f "$MIR_SERVER_FILE"
rm -f "${MIR_SERVER_FILE}_trusted"
